# Building Access — Fairhall Pop-Up Office

During the Novembra Trade Fair, Quillstone Ltd operates a temporary office in Hall 4, Booth Row C. Visiting contractors should enter through the eastern service corridor, which stays unlocked between 07:30 and 19:00. Outside those hours, the corridor gate requires a pass. Sign the contractor log at the booth before starting work. The gate code for this week is:

badge for hahip-bagag: bdg-FIJ-9

## v3.8.0 — Setting Renamed

For the weekly sync: the exam-proctoring queue setting PROCTOR_QUEUE_KEY has been renamed to VIGILANT_QUEUE_CREDENTIAL to match the Vigilant rebrand. The old name is still read as a fallback until v4.0, after which workers will refuse to start without the new one. Deploys through Lanternwick CI already use the new name. Update your local env files now: the renamed credential entry should appear immediately below this note.

env line for tawig-kadup: VAULT_KEY5=07c4f

TURN-208: Gatevale turnstile counters at the Merrow Field pilot double-count when a rotation reverses mid-cycle. Attendance totals drift roughly 2% high per event. The debounce window fix is implemented, reviewed by Ilsa, and soak-tested across two simulated match days without drift. Ready for your cut; the candidate build is identified below.

trace token, tagag-tafog: htk6_5ed18c

## Break-Glass: Stale-Cache Postmortem Archive

Context: the Ferndock stale-cache incident affected third-party plugins; the full postmortem is sealed pending review. External plugin authors needing early access for compatibility fixes may use break-glass. Access is logged; misuse revokes registry privileges. Request approval from the Ferndock incident lead, then open the sealed archive and authenticate with the recovery passphrase below.

vault phrase of hawif-bahof = novvan-belius-istael-fenvan-holdor-druox-eliath